The usual reason a programme changes supplier is not unit price. It is documentation that arrived after the container shipped, or a supplier who changed material without saying so. Both are specification problems, and both are preventable.

Questions buyers ask
What happens if a lot fails inspection?
The lot is re-inspected against the golden sample, and replacement pieces ship on the next available booking at our cost.
What testing is included?
Standard lots ship with dimensional and hardness reports. REACH documentation is issued with the shipment when your market requires it.
What is the minimum order quantity?
The standard MOQ is 3000 pieces per specification. Mixed sizes inside one shipment are accepted once the total reaches that figure.
Can you match an existing sample?
Send a sample and we will reverse-engineer the specification, then produce a counter sample for approval before any bulk starts.
